T.D.L S.B.S Trinidad 2008
Not your usual soft TDL — the nose can come across sharp, closed, even tarry and camphor-like at first, and a couple of tasters caught an artificial "Toffifee" edge. Give it air and it opens into caramel, citrus, cinnamon, nutty hazelnut and warming cocoa, with the Madeira cask leaning in hard. One member called it a well hidden gem; another found the wood a touch musty.

How does T.D.L S.B.S Trinidad 2008 taste?
Aggregated from 27 community reviews.
Nutty, cocoa-rich Madeira-finished Trinidad, needs air Divides people. The palate — cocoa, nuts, cinnamon, dark chocolate — wins most over, but the sharp nose, dominant Madeira and 57% alcohol don't always integrate. Needs to breathe.
People who like nutty, dry, Madeira-influenced sippers at cask strength
Anyone wanting a soft, easy TDL or bothered by a sharp nose

Review by Christoph
The taste is clearly more pleasant than the nose. If the somewhat pungent smell would not be one could better perceive notes of dark chocolate. In the taste then clearly more fruity than in the nose and in addition warm notes of cocoa that condense with time. After a while in the glass clearly chocolate. At the beginning something meaty and cinnamon, which unfortunately does not really fit together. Must breathe in any case.
Review by Morgan Garet
The nose is rather closed on tar and camphor, then after opening, the gourmandise tdl is very present. The palate opens with caramel, citrus, and cinnamon. Then the Madeira cask is discreet but still present, accompanied by beautiful hazelnut notes. Long finish on Madeira wine (spices/grapes).
